What is a Thyroid Cyst?

A thyroid cyst is a fluid-filled swelling that develops inside the thyroid gland. The thyroid is a small, butterfly-shaped gland located in the front of your neck. It plays an important role in controlling your body’s metabolism, energy levels, and hormones.

Thyroid cysts are usually:

  • Non-cancerous (benign)
  • Slow-growing
  • Filled with fluid or semi-solid material

Some cysts remain small and harmless, while others may grow and cause visible swelling or discomfort.

Types of Thyroid Cysts

Understanding the type of cyst helps in choosing the right Thyroid Cyst Treatment Without Surgery.

1. Simple Cysts

These are completely filled with fluid and are usually harmless.

2. Complex Cysts

These contain both fluid and solid parts. They may need closer evaluation.

3. Recurrent Cysts

These cysts come back again after fluid removal and may need advanced treatment.

Symptoms of Thyroid Cyst

In many cases, thyroid cysts do not cause symptoms. But when they grow, you may notice:

  • Lump or swelling in the neck
  • Pain or tenderness
  • Difficulty swallowing
  • Pressure in the throat
  • Cosmetic concerns (visible swelling)
  • Rarely, voice changes

Causes of Thyroid Cyst

The exact cause is not always known, but common reasons include:

  • Degeneration of thyroid nodules
  • Hormonal imbalance
  • Iodine deficiency
  • Aging
  • Genetic factors

Even though most cysts are harmless, proper medical evaluation is important.

Diagnosis of Thyroid Cyst

Before starting Thyroid Cyst Treatment Without Surgery, doctors perform a proper diagnosis.

Common Tests Include:

  • Ultrasound Scan – Shows size and type of cyst
  • Fine Needle Aspiration (FNA) – Removes fluid for testing
  • Thyroid Function Tests – Check hormone levels

These tests help confirm whether the cyst is benign and suitable for non-surgical treatment.

Best Thyroid Cyst Treatment Without Surgery Options

1. Needle Aspiration

This is the simplest method.

Procedure:

  • A thin needle is inserted into the cyst
  • Fluid is removed
  • Swelling reduces immediately

Advantages:

  • Quick and simple
  • No hospital stay
  • Immediate relief

Disadvantage:

  • Cyst may come back

2. Ethanol Ablation (Alcohol Injection)

This is one of the most effective methods for Thyroid Cyst Treatment Without Surgery.

Procedure:

  • Fluid is removed
  • Alcohol is injected into the cyst
  • It destroys cyst lining and shrinks it

Advantages:

  • High success rate
  • Low recurrence
  • Safe and quick

3. Radiofrequency Ablation (RFA)

This is an advanced and modern treatment.

Procedure:

  • A special probe is inserted into the cyst
  • Heat energy destroys the cyst tissue
  • The cyst shrinks over time

Advantages:

  • Long-lasting results
  • No surgery required
  • Minimal discomfort

4. Can a thyroid cyst come back after non-surgical treatment?

In some cases, simple fluid removal may lead to recurrence. However, advanced treatments like ethanol ablation or radiofrequency ablation significantly reduce the chances of the cyst coming back.
